Solution for 8x-(3x+2)+x=5x+2 equation:


Simplifying
8x + -1(3x + 2) + x = 5x + 2

Reorder the terms:
8x + -1(2 + 3x) + x = 5x + 2
8x + (2 * -1 + 3x * -1) + x = 5x + 2
8x + (-2 + -3x) + x = 5x + 2

Reorder the terms:
-2 + 8x + -3x + x = 5x + 2

Combine like terms: 8x + -3x = 5x
-2 + 5x + x = 5x + 2

Combine like terms: 5x + x = 6x
-2 + 6x = 5x + 2

Reorder the terms:
-2 + 6x = 2 + 5x

Solving
-2 + 6x = 2 + 5x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-5x' to each side of the equation.
-2 + 6x + -5x = 2 + 5x + -5x

Combine like terms: 6x + -5x = 1x
-2 + 1x = 2 + 5x + -5x

Combine like terms: 5x + -5x = 0
-2 + 1x = 2 + 0
-2 + 1x = 2

Add '2' to each side of the equation.
-2 + 2 + 1x = 2 + 2

Combine like terms: -2 + 2 = 0
0 + 1x = 2 + 2
1x = 2 + 2

Combine like terms: 2 + 2 = 4
1x = 4

Divide each side by '1'.
x = 4

Simplifying
x = 4
